Output ebedb21a9022df080994c8b43cf79214126a5c5368c2ee1662ceb7b4d1d4bf1b:3

value
35398004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f06bec19008d775152c6a0df41232a4141a928 OP_EQUAL
address
MDN67XoGc4YTRGN5LbfzXYs59hnhBA7kQL
transaction
ebedb21a9022df080994c8b43cf79214126a5c5368c2ee1662ceb7b4d1d4bf1b
spent
true